#7012d6 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7012d6 is composed of 43.9% red, 7.1% green and 83.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47.7% cyan, 91.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 268.8 degrees, a saturation of 84.5% and a lightness of 45.5%. #7012d6 color hex could be obtained by blending #e024ff with #0000ad. Closest websafe color is: #6600cc.

Shades and Tints of #7012d6

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#08010f is the darkest color, while #fdfcff is the lightest one.
